我是docker的新手,我想在容器中挂载当前目录并运行命令。
使用文档文件
将当前目录安装在文件夹中,例如文件
EG:
FROM ubuntu As tuttt
VOLUME [ %cd% ]
ENTRYPOINT ["/bin/bash"]
RUN ls
答案 0 :(得分:2)
运行容器时将装入卷。 Dockerfile是构建映像的步骤的定义。从图像中运行一个容器。
您可以构建图像(删除VOLUME声明,因为它在您的情况下没有用),然后使用以下命令运行它:
docker run -v <host_path>:<container_path> <image_tag>